I have a friend who wants to learn to ride. She has learned that I have a horse, and has now asked if I will help her learn to ride.

I am a little unsure of this to be honest. I don't want to be responsible for an accident. I know that I could have her sign a contract stating that I am not liable for any injury, but I also don't know how I feel about having someone else riding my horse.

Have you left friends ride your horse?

I have let friends ride my horse, but not often, more of a "pony ride" type of thing. I have spent alot of time training Pumpkin the way I want him, and if I am to be successful with showing and exhibitions I need him to not get "untrained" or confused by another rider. He's a bit more stubborn than the well trained push button types we use for lessons. On the other hand you have the ability to teach your friend how to ride your horse how you want him/her ridden which could be a good thing.
